Why perfectionism slows progress, what’s really happening in your brain and body, and how to break the loop — on and off your mountain bike.


In this episode, I dive into one of the biggest hidden blockers in adult MTB learning: perfectionism. If you’ve ever caught yourself thinking, “I should be better by now,” or you get frustrated when a skill doesn’t click instantly — this episode is for you. We’ll explore why perfectionism isn’t just about “high standards” but a protective mechanism of your brain, what happens physiologically when you tense up and over-focus on mistakes, and — most importantly — how to shift out of that loop and back into learning flow.


You’ll walk away with concrete, science-backed tools to calm your nervous system, rewire your brain for real progress, and finally enjoy the process — instead of chasing “perfect.”


🚵‍♀️ You’ll learn:

- Why perfectionism is actually a form of fear and self-protection


- What your dopamine and cortisol systems have to do with frustration and flow


- How tension blocks coordination and confidence


- Simple “in-the-moment” resets to shift from frustration to focus


- Why imperfection is the key to long-term skill growth


- How to literally train your nervous system, not just your muscles
